Cookies

Our website uses cookies. Cookies are small text files consisting of a series of numbers and letters that are stored on the terminal device you are using. Cookies neither transmit viruses nor can they execute programs. Rather, they are primarily used to exchange information between the end device you are using and our website in order to make our website more user-friendly and effective for you. A distinction must be made between temporary (transient) cookies and persistent cookies. Transient cookies include session cookies in particular. These store a so-called session ID, which can be used to assign various requests from your browser to the joint session. This enables our website to recognize your computer when you return to our website. The session cookies are deleted when you log out or close your browser. Persistent cookies are automatically deleted after a specified period, which may vary depending on the cookie. You have the option of deleting these cookies at any time in the security settings of your browser.

Your rights under the DSGVO

According to the DSGVO, you are entitled to the rights listed below, which you can assert at any time with the responsible person named in section 1 of this data protection declaration:

Right of access: Pursuant to Art. 15 DSGVO, you may request confirmation as to whether and which of your personal data we process. In addition, you may request from us free of charge information on the processing purposes, the category of personal data, the categories of recipients to whom your data have been or will be disclosed, the planned storage period, the existence of a right to rectification, deletion, restriction of processing or objection, the existence of a right of complaint and the origin of your data, if not collected from us. You also have a right to know whether your personal data has been transferred to a third country or to an international organisation. If this is the case, you have the right to obtain information about the appropriate guarantees in connection with the transfer.
Right to rectification: Pursuant to Art. 16 DSGVO, you may request the correction of incorrect or incomplete personal data stored by us and relating to you.
Right to deletion: In accordance with Art. 17 DSGVO, you have the right to request the deletion of your personal data stored by us, provided that we do not require their processing for the following purposes:
to fulfil a legal obligation,
to assert, exercise or defend legal claims,
the exercise of freedom of expression and information, or
for reasons of the cases of public interest referred to in Article 17(3)(c) and (d) DSGVO.
Right to limitation: Pursuant to Art. 18 DSGVO, you have the right to request limitation of the processing of your personal data if
the accuracy of the data is disputed by you for a period of time that allows us to verify the accuracy of the personal data,
the processing of your data is unlawful, but you refuse to delete it and instead demand that the use of the data be restricted,
we no longer need the personal data for the purposes of processing, but you need the data for the assertion, exercise or defence of legal claims
you have objected to the processing of your data in accordance with Art. 21 DSGVO, but it is not yet clear whether the justified reasons which entitle us to further processing despite your objection outweigh your rights.
Right to be informed: If you have asserted the right to correction, deletion or restriction of processing against us, we are obliged to inform all recipients to whom the personal data concerning you have been disclosed of the correction or deletion of the data requested by you or the restriction of processing, unless this proves to be impossible or involves disproportionate effort. You have the right to be informed by us of such recipients.
Right to data transfer: Pursuant to Art. 20 DSGVO, you may request that we receive the personal data concerning you that you have provided to us in a structured, common and machine-readable format or request that it be transferred to another responsible party.
Right of complaint: According to Art. 77 DSGVO, you have the right to complain to a supervisory authority. For this purpose, you can contact the supervisory authority of your usual place of residence, your place of work or our company headquarters.

YouTube

On this website we use components from YouTube, a service of YouTube, LLC, 901 Cherry Ave, San Bruno, CA 94066, USA. YouTube, LLC is a subsidiary of Google Inc., 1600 Amphitheatre Parkway, Mountain View, CA 94043-1351, USA.

The use of Youtube allows us to embed various videos and clips made available on the www.youtube.de Internet platform. After a page or subpage of our website is accessed on which such embedding has taken place, the Internet browser you are using is prompted to download video components of the embedded video or clip. During your visit to our website and its subpages, both Youtube and Google will be informed of which page or subpage you have accessed by transmitting your IP address to Google’s external servers in the United States. This information is transmitted regardless of whether the displayed videos or clips are actually viewed or clicked, or whether you are logged into your Youtube or Google account. Google Web Fonts

We use „Google Web Fonts“, a service of Google Inc., 1600 Amphitheatre Parkway, Mountain View, CA 94043, USA, on our website.

The service enables us to integrate the representation of external fonts (web fonts) into the design of our website and to display them correctly when the website is displayed. This gives us certain creative possibilities to make the design of our website more user-friendly. The integration of these web fonts takes place via a server call. From this server, the fonts are delivered compressed to your browser and unpacked there. This server is regularly located in the USA. If you visit one of our pages on which we integrate Google Fonts, it will be transmitted to Google which of our Internet pages you have visited. In addition, the IP address of the browser of the visitor’s terminal device is stored by Google. Purpose: The aforementioned interests represent the purpose of using Google Web Fonts. PayPal

On our website, we offer payment processing via the payment service provider PayPal (PayPal (Europe) S.à.r.l. &amp; Cie. S.C.A., 22-24 Boulevard Royal, 2449 Luxembourg, Luxembourg).

If you have chosen to pay via PayPal, the following of your details will be sent to PayPal as part of your order: First and last name, address, date of birth, e-mail address, telephone number, IP address and the data necessary for the processing of the respective order. The transmission of these data takes place, so that PayPal can accomplish an identity check for the completion of your purchase. This allows us to recognize fraudulent activities and to prevent the misuse of data. In addition, the data is transmitted so that PayPal can assess your creditworthiness or PayPal can pass the data to credit agencies to assess your creditworthiness in the form of a credit check. PayPal uses the result of the credit check in relation to the statistical probability of non-payment for the purpose of deciding on the provision of the respective payment method. The data collected may also be used by PayPal for analytical purposes, including but not limited to customer analysis, risk analysis, data analysis for the purpose of developing and improving the services offered by PayPal.
